[PATCH v8 01/13] clk: qcom: Add support for GDSCs

Rajendra Nayak rnayak at codeaurora.org
Thu Aug 6 03:37:42 PDT 2015


From: Stephen Boyd <sboyd at codeaurora.org>

GDSCs (Global Distributed Switch Controllers) are responsible for
safely collapsing and restoring power to peripherals in the SoC.
These are best modelled as power domains using genpd and given
the registers are scattered throughout the clock controller register
space, its best to have the support added through the clock driver.

+#define PWR_ON_MASK		BIT(31)
+#define EN_REST_WAIT_MASK	GENMASK_ULL(23, 20)
+#define EN_FEW_WAIT_MASK	GENMASK_ULL(19, 16)
+#define CLK_DIS_WAIT_MASK	GENMASK_ULL(15, 12)
+#define SW_OVERRIDE_MASK	BIT(2)
+#define HW_CONTROL_MASK		BIT(1)
+#define SW_COLLAPSE_MASK	BIT(0)
+
+/* Wait 2^n CXO cycles between all states. Here, n=2 (4 cycles). */
+#define EN_REST_WAIT_VAL	(0x2 << 20)
+#define EN_FEW_WAIT_VAL		(0x8 << 16)
+#define CLK_DIS_WAIT_VAL	(0x2 << 12)
+
+#define TIMEOUT_US		100
+
+#define domain_to_gdsc(domain) container_of(domain, struct gdsc, pd)
+
+static int gdsc_is_enabled(struct gdsc *sc)
+{
+	u32 val;
+	int ret;
+
+	ret = regmap_read(sc->regmap, sc->gdscr, &val);
+	if (ret)
+		return ret;
+
+	return !!(val & PWR_ON_MASK);
+}
+
+static int gdsc_toggle_logic(struct gdsc *sc, bool en)
+{
+	int ret;
+	u32 val = en ? 0 : SW_COLLAPSE_MASK;
+	u32 check = en ? PWR_ON_MASK : 0;
+	unsigned long timeout;
+
+	ret = regmap_update_bits(sc->regmap, sc->gdscr, SW_COLLAPSE_MASK, val);
+	if (ret)
+		return ret;
+
+	timeout = jiffies + usecs_to_jiffies(TIMEOUT_US);
+	do {
+		ret = regmap_read(sc->regmap, sc->gdscr, &val);
+		if (ret)
+			return ret;
+
+		if ((val & PWR_ON_MASK) == check)
+			return 0;
+	} while (time_before(jiffies, timeout));
+
+	ret = regmap_read(sc->regmap, sc->gdscr, &val);
+	if (ret)
+		return ret;
+
+	if ((val & PWR_ON_MASK) == check)
+		return 0;
+
+	return -ETIMEDOUT;
+}
+
+static int gdsc_enable(struct generic_pm_domain *domain)
+{
+	struct gdsc *sc = domain_to_gdsc(domain);
+	int ret;
+
+	ret = gdsc_toggle_logic(sc, true);
+	if (ret)
+		return ret;
+	/*
+	 * If clocks to this power domain were already on, they will take an
+	 * additional 4 clock cycles to re-enable after the power domain is
+	 * enabled. Delay to account for this. A delay is also needed to ensure
+	 * clocks are not enabled within 400ns of enabling power to the
+	 * memories.
+	 */
+	udelay(1);
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static int gdsc_disable(struct generic_pm_domain *domain)
+{
+	struct gdsc *sc = domain_to_gdsc(domain);
+
+	return gdsc_toggle_logic(sc, false);
+}
+
+static int gdsc_init(struct gdsc *sc)
+{
+	u32 mask, val;
+	int on, ret;
+
+	/*
+	 * Disable HW trigger: collapse/restore occur based on registers writes.
+	 * Disable SW override: Use hardware state-machine for sequencing.
+	 * Configure wait time between states.
+	 */
+	mask = HW_CONTROL_MASK | SW_OVERRIDE_MASK |
+	       EN_REST_WAIT_MASK | EN_FEW_WAIT_MASK | CLK_DIS_WAIT_MASK;
+	val = EN_REST_WAIT_VAL | EN_FEW_WAIT_VAL | CLK_DIS_WAIT_VAL;
+	ret = regmap_update_bits(sc->regmap, sc->gdscr, mask, val);
+	if (ret)
+		return ret;
+
+	on = gdsc_is_enabled(sc);
+	if (on < 0)
+		return on;
+
+	sc->pd.power_off = gdsc_disable;
+	sc->pd.power_on = gdsc_enable;
+	pm_genpd_init(&sc->pd, NULL, !on);
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+int gdsc_register(struct device *dev, struct gdsc **scs, size_t num,
+		  struct regmap *regmap)
+{
+	int i, ret;
+	struct genpd_onecell_data *data;
+
+	data = devm_kzalloc(dev, sizeof(*data), GFP_KERNEL);
+	if (!data)
+		return -ENOMEM;
+
+	data->domains = devm_kcalloc(dev, num, sizeof(*data->domains),
+				     GFP_KERNEL);
+	if (!data->domains)
+		return -ENOMEM;
+
+	data->num_domains = num;
+	for (i = 0; i < num; i++) {
+		if (!scs[i])
+			continue;
+		scs[i]->regmap = regmap;
+		ret = gdsc_init(scs[i]);
+		if (ret)
+			return ret;
+		data->domains[i] = &scs[i]->pd;
+	}
+
+	return of_genpd_add_provider_onecell(dev->of_node, data);
+}
+
+void gdsc_unregister(struct device *dev)
+{
+	of_genpd_del_provider(dev->of_node);
+}
